Web6 The Aberdare Commission of Enquiry into Reformatory and Industrial Schools 1884, which dealt with the British and Irish systems separately, warmly endorsed the schools. Partly as a result of this, there was a considerable expansion in industrial schools in the 1880s and 1890s. WebDec 3, 2024 · In 1950 there were three reformatories and 51 industrial schools in the country, all run by religious orders.
